A charming and full of character period home, located in a peaceful setting, down a private, no through road. Stunning field views, and only a few minutes from Stratford-upon-Avon and the M40. Set in a 0.2 acre plot, with a pergola, raised lawn and benefitting from a workshop/garden office.
Entrance Porch - with tiled floor, and double glazed window to the side.
Reception Hall - with tiled floor, and column radiator.
Kitchen/Breakfast/Family Room - 7.17m max x 6.26m max (23'6" max x 20'6" max) - with tile flooring, large doors to patio area in garden, original fireplace, wall cabinets and eye level cabinets, island with cupboards, integrated fridge/freezer, double oven and electric hob, one and a half sink with mixer tap.
Dining Room - 3.79m x 5.02m (12'5" x 16'5") - with tile flooring, radiators, two double glazed patio doors to rear garden and double glazed window to the side.
Living Room - 3.96m x 4.18m (12'11" x 13'8") - with tile flooring, radiator, double glazed window to the front and log fireplace.
Utility Room - with radiator, space for washing machine and dishwasher, double glazed side door and window.
Cloakroom - with wc, wash hand basin, double glazed window, cupboard and half height tiling.
Landing - with double glazed window to the rear.
Bedroom One - 3.80m x 3.82m (12'5" x 12'6") - with radiator, 2 velux sky lights, double glazed windows to side and front.
Ensuite Shower Room - with shower, wc, wash hand basin, tiled floor, extractor fan, towel rail and tiling to half height.
Bedroom Two - 3.98m x 3.01m (13'0" x 9'10") - with radiator, double glazed window to the side and access to the loft.
Bedroom Three - 3.03m x 4.22m (9'11" x 13'10") - with radiator, double glazed window to the side and fitted wardrobes.
Family Bathroom - with tiled floor, extractor fan, double shower cubicle, wc, wash hand basin, bath tub, radiator and two double glazed windows to the side.
Front Gardens - laid to gravel and lawn with mature trees and shrubs and providing space for 3+ cars.
Back Gardens - with paved concrete area with pergola, raised lawn area with trees and shrubs and access to garden office.
Garden Office - 5.12m x 5.52m max (16'9" x 18'1" max) - with laminate flooring, partition to media section, two double glazed windows, door to the front, and velux to ceiling.
General Information - The property is freehold.
The property is connected to a cesspit, last emptied 10th July, 2025. Access to the septic tank is in the field opposite the house. The property benefits from right of access as part of the title.
